What is a Flotilla?

A Flotilla is much like a sailing parade; you head off on a general sailing itinerary, sailing in company with other yachts. It is a great way to sail with the family and meet a lot of friends with the same interests. The flotilla is well supported with a lead of safety crew with great knowledge of the St. John River. This gives you all the support you need to minimize the worry.
